Velo3D’s metal AM technology to accelerate production for the U.S. Navy’s nuclear fleet

Bechtel Plant Machinery Inc. (BPMI) has selected Velo3D’s fully integrated metal AM system for the U.S. Naval Nuclear Propulsion Program. Featuring Velo3D’s Sapphire XC large format printer calibrated for stainless steel 415, the selected solution will be operated by materials company ATI, at its newly established additive manufacturing facility located outside Fort Lauderdale, Florida. Continuum’s Recycled Metal Powders Now Available on Velo3D 3D Printers – 3DPrint.com

Adoption is crucial for the success of metal powders made from recycled scrap in the additive manufacturing (AM) industry. The prevalent concerns about recycled powder—its perceived inferiority to new powder, doubts about achieving consistent properties from scrap-based powder, and skepticism about its suitability for critical applications like aircraft manufacturing—are significant barriers to its widespread acceptance. a Raspberry Pi Pico-based 24 channel logic analyzer « Adafruit Industries – Makers, hackers, artists, designers and engineers!

Agustín Gimenez Bernad leads development of LogicAnalyzer, an inexpensive 24 channel logic analyzer with 100Msps, 32k samples deep, edge triggers and pattern triggers.
